CCD: What do you consider as a major challenge in the Legal Department?
SS: The major challenge facing us as Legal Officers is police misconduct. For example, there are cases of witness tampering or police corruption, which can lead to miscarriage of justice. In an effort to control police misconduct as a lawyer, you have to go beyond your role of giving legal advice, to engage directly in pretrial investigations otherwise it will be very difficult to secure conviction in any case.

CCD: What do you consider your major achievement since you assumed duty?
SS: One of my major achievements as Legal Officer, is the success recorded in the case of Cop v. Faruk Hussaini & 3 others. It was a case of vandalism where the vandals were sentenced to two years imprisonment despite the fatal error of not tendering an exhibit made by the police prosecutor. But I was able to cure the error by making the required application before the court otherwise the convicts would have been discharged by the court.
